94351 ConfigurationActivator no longer needs to call internal runtime methods
diff --git a/update/org.eclipse.update.configurator/src/org/eclipse/update/internal/configurator/ConfigurationActivator.java b/update/org.eclipse.update.configurator/src/org/eclipse/update/internal/configurator/ConfigurationActivator.java
index fe25597..bd6f8b7 100644
--- a/update/org.eclipse.update.configurator/src/org/eclipse/update/internal/configurator/ConfigurationActivator.java
+++ b/update/org.eclipse.update.configurator/src/org/eclipse/update/internal/configurator/ConfigurationActivator.java
@@ -382,7 +382,7 @@
String configArea = configLocation.getURL().getFile();
lastTimeStamp = configuration.getChangeStamp();
- lastStateTimeStamp = Platform.getPlatformAdmin().getState(false).getTimeStamp();
+ lastStateTimeStamp = Platform.getStateStamp();
stream = new DataOutputStream(new FileOutputStream(configArea +File.separator+ NAME_SPACE+ File.separator+ LAST_CONFIG_STAMP));
stream.writeLong(lastTimeStamp);
stream.writeLong(lastStateTimeStamp);
@@ -417,7 +417,7 @@
private boolean canRunWithCachedData() {
return !"true".equals(System.getProperty("osgi.checkConfiguration")) && //$NON-NLS-1$ //$NON-NLS-2$
lastTimeStamp==configuration.getChangeStamp() &&
- lastStateTimeStamp==Platform.getPlatformAdmin().getState(false).getTimeStamp();
+ lastStateTimeStamp==Platform.getStateStamp();
}
public static BundleContext getBundleContext() {